Привет джунам и сеньёрам с дтф! Решил вот серьёзно заняться изучением веб-программированием, но сам полный ноль в этом и толком не знаю за что взяться. И на первое время надо бы озаботиться инструментарием, а его в интернете куча и совершенно не понятно по началу что с ним да как. И вот решил я спросить у наших знатоков, может кто в курсе чем бы вооружиться на первых порах и какие приложения лучше использовать? Совершенно не хочется парить себе мозг, чтобы потом узнать, что все работают в какой-то программе, которая упрощает жизнь юзеру во много раз.
537
просмотров
vscode для написания кода. Многие любят IDE от jetbrains
insomnia для сохранения и отправки запросов (полезно при отладке)
dbeaver для подключения к БД, просмотра и изменения данных (если будешь работать только с mysql и на собственном сервере, то можно phpmyadmin, у jetbrains есть прекрасный datagrip)
keepass или другой менеджер паролей, их у тебя накопится много
simplenote или что-то еще для хранения заметок и кусков кода
если на винде, то ssh клиент, хз что там сейчас популярно, на линуксе и маке уже есть свои
что-то для синхронизации локальной папки с кодом с папкой на сервере, на линуксе и маке проще всего использовать rsync, вроде бы он и для винды был... многие используют ftp но это довольно тормознутое решение для больших проектов
Чем прекрасен datagrip?
интерфейсом, в dbeaver он слегка уебищный, как у многих опенсорсных решений
Webstorm/IDEA
/thread
Ну тут без вариантов. Сколько не пытался обмазывать всякие VSCode’ы плагинами, получалось даже не близко к нормальной IDE.
Webstorm советовал один знакомый программист, наверное действительно хорошая весч.
Ничего лучше не найдёшь, можешь не пытаться даже и никого не слушать, у них есть CE, она бесплатная, так что качай её и кайфуй.
Webstorm/IDEA они же платные вроде.
https://www.jetbrains.com/idea/download/?fromIDE=#section=windows
Вторая кнопка, community edition, она бесплатная
Что за CE?
Community edition
А где взять? Я думал WebStorm полностью платный.
https://www.jetbrains.com/idea/download/?fromIDE=#section=windows
Я про IDEA, вторая кнопка
Хм, судя по сайту, там нет поддержки HTML / CSS / JS?
https://www.jetbrains.com/webstorm/nextversion есть вот такой вариант ещё, он тоже бесплатный.
Да, уже заметил, но я хз на чем ОП пишет, если для джавы, то пойдёт.
Соре за дезинфу.
Да ничего, я учу фронтенд сейчас, поэтому значит буду дальше сидеть на VS Code) Если стану программистом 300к / наносекунда, то тогда и WebStorm можно))
Продолжай сидеть на VScode даже с 300к/наносекунду
А с 350?
А с 350 переходи на Sublime.
Для совсем джуна - лучше не надо.
Причина - сильно упрощает написание кода, практически за разработчика может целые конструкции переписывать.
Я так же ремонтом дома занимаюсь время от времени. Выбираю классный лазерный метр, дрель макита, шуруповерт бош... А потом все это пылится ¯\_(ツ)_/¯
VS Code + плагины
VS Code однозначно
Блокнот
Наконец-то долистал, думал уже самому придётся писать
ide от jetbrains много делают за тебя, там прям при создании проекта рабочий hello world создаётся всякие гуи для работы с гитом, бд. и тд
Может меня щас закидают гнилыми помидорами, но если прям вообще начинающий погромист, то серьезные IDE лучше не брать. Они мало того, что авто заполнением пишут чуть не половину кода, так и многие моменты очень сильно упрощают. Проблема не сильно большая, но стоит забрать IDE, то произойдет пук среньк, т.к. ты не знаешь как к примеру запушить код в репу из консоли. Учись работать без IDE, да сложнее, но оно того стоит. А к среде разработки потом быстро привыкнешь, когда освоишься с базовыми инструментами.
Visual studio code(ну хорошо бы было знать на чем пишешь)
хз на чем ты там писать будешь, но vscode с любым говном будет работать
JetBrains Webstorm